Architectural shingle replacements in the Charlotte metro typically run $9,000–$25,000 in 2026. Here's what drives the price, and how to read a roofing estimate so you don't get burned.
Most full-tear-off architectural shingle roof replacements on a 2,000–3,000 sq ft single-family home in the Charlotte metro area run between $9,000 and $25,000 in 2026.
